Resistin is a hormone that has gained significant attention in recent years due to its involvement in insulin resistance and the complications surrounding diabetes. As a cytokine secreted by adipose (fat) tissue, resistin is believed to play a critical role in how the body responds to insulin. Elevated levels of resistin have been linked to increased inflammation, obesity, and type 2 diabetes. Recognizing the detrimental effects of resistin is essential for those seeking to restore healthy blood sugar levels naturally.
Understanding how resistin functions is the first step in combating its effects. When resistin levels are high, it can interfere with insulin’s ability to regulate blood sugar, often leading to increased glucose production in the liver while simultaneously inhibiting glucose uptake by muscle and fat cells. In simple terms, high levels of resistin can contribute to insulin resistance, a key factor in the development of type 2 diabetes. Therefore, neutralizing resistin’s effects is crucial for maintaining balanced blood sugar levels.
One of the most effective ways to combat resistin is through dietary adjustments. Foods that are high in fiber, such as fruits, vegetables, and whole grains, can help modulate blood sugar levels. Fiber-rich foods slow down the absorption of sugar, ultimately preventing spikes in blood glucose. Incorporating healthy fats, such as those found in avocados, nuts, and olive oil, can also promote overall metabolic health and assist in reducing resistin levels.
Regular physical activity is another cornerstone of managing blood sugar naturally. Exercise helps increase insulin sensitivity, meaning the body can utilize insulin more effectively. This, in turn, helps lower levels of resistin. Aerobic exercises, strength training, and even activities like yoga can all contribute to a more balanced metabolic profile, making it easier to control blood sugar levels and manage resistin.
Managing stress is a vital aspect of overall health that often goes overlooked. Chronic stress can lead to elevated levels of cortisol, a hormone that exacerbates insulin resistance and can subsequently elevate resistin levels. Techniques such as mindfulness, meditation, and deep-breathing exercises can be beneficial in reducing stress and its negative impact on metabolic health. By incorporating stress management techniques, individuals can create a holistic approach that effectively tackles the challenges associated with resistin.
Additionally, getting adequate sleep is essential for maintaining hormonal balance, including those that affect blood sugar levels. Poor sleep quality can lead to increased insulin resistance and elevated blood sugar levels. Establishing a consistent sleep schedule and creating a restful sleep environment can make a significant difference in how the body regulates hormones, including resistin.
Another important factor is maintaining a healthy weight. Excess body fat, particularly around the abdomen, is linked to higher levels of resistin. By achieving and maintaining a healthy weight through balanced nutrition and regular exercise, individuals can help reduce resistin levels and support better insulin sensitivity.
